A vessel of brass, gleaming with quiet patina, its form lifted proudly by a stand of lion paw feet. The teapot rests above a warmer, promising both function and grace, while the wooden handle arcs steady above. It is a piece of ceremony as much as service, recalling parlors where time moved gently with tea.
More than utility, it is a fragment of history, ornate yet purposeful, carrying with it the elegance of Victorian style. Within your décor, it becomes centerpiece, relic, and timeless companion to gathering.
Measurements: 10.5"H x 11.25"W x 8.5"D
Weight: 4.3 lb
Origin: Unknown
Age: Early 20th Century
